Anhui Shipbuilding Output Value Up 33% to 21.3B Yuan in First Eight Months

Anhui province’s shipbuilding industry posted total output value of 21.3 billion yuan in the first eight months of the year, up 33% year on year. Ship completions reached 1.33 million deadweight tonnes, up 18%, while new orders jumped about 302% to 6.48 million dwt and the order backlog rose roughly 140% to 10.81 million dwt.
